📝 Ingredients:
* Sesame Seeds (Til): 150g
* Peanuts: 200g
* Jaggery (Gud): 300g
* Milk Powder: 2 tbsp (The game changer!)
* Dry Ginger Powder: 1 tsp
* Cardamom Powder: 1 tsp
* Pistachios: For garnish
.
Recipe –
– Take 150 gm Til (sesame seeds), dry roast them and let it cool down.
– Take 200 gm peanuts, dry roast and once it cools down, remove the skin.
– Now coarsely grind toasted sesame seeds and peanuts together.
– Take it out in a bowl, into that add 2 tbs milk powder (optional).
– Now in a kadhai, melt 300 gm jaggery.
– Once it’s completely melted, and when you see one boil, turn off the heat and add 1 tsp dry ginger powder and 1 tsp elaichi powder.
– Then add sesame and peanuts mix.
– Mix it well (tip : do this mixing part quickly when jaggery is hot.)
– Take out the mixture into a well-greased thali.
– Garnish with chopped pista and when the sukhdi is hot; give it the cuts.
– Once it completely cools down, take it out and store it in air tight container.
